top | all

Leawood, KS, USA
30+ days ago
Phoenix, AZ, USA
30+ days ago

Oakland, CA, USA
30+ days ago

Sioux Falls, SD, USA
30+ days ago

Kampala, Uganda
30+ days ago

Oak Park, CA, USA
30+ days ago

Princeton, NJ, USA
30+ days ago

Princeton, NJ, USA
30+ days ago

Princeton, NJ, USA
30+ days ago

Princeton, NJ, USA
30+ days ago

Chandler, AZ, USA
30+ days ago

Los Angeles, CA, USA
30+ days ago

Remote, OR, USA
30+ days ago

Lexington, MA, USA
30+ days ago